webforms - Google Tag Manager 代码是否应该插入到 ASP.NET Site.Master 中?
问题描述
我们正在我们的网站中实施 Google 跟踪代码管理器。该站点是一个 ASP.NET Web 窗体站点。在我看来,实现这一点的最佳方法是在 Site.Master.aspx 中插入 Google 代码 - 这是正确的,还是有更好的方法?
谢谢!
解决方案
对于我们的 webforms 网站,我们将标签管理器代码放在母版页中,既是为了确保代码在正确的位置(在 body 标签的最开始处),也是为了轻松将其加载到每个页面上。除非你有一些不寻常的情况,否则我认为这对我来说是最合乎逻辑的。
推荐阅读
- amazon-web-services - AWS CloudShell - AWS-PHP-SDK 从实例配置文件元数据服务检索凭证时出错
- javascript - 使用 OData 模型在间隔时间内更改表格的单元格
- php - 通过浏览器集成下载管理器阻止视频下载
- excel - For Each Loop 使用 Columns() 返回完整范围
- less - 是否可以用一个类包装 LESS 导入并呈现其基本样式定义?
- php - Pagerfanta 模板导致诗篇错误
- python - 用按钮调用覆盖 tkinter 笔记本需要多少钱?
- c# - Blazor:使用 EditForm-Component 加载页面时 _Host.cshtml 中出现 NullReferenceException
- html - Javascript 中的滑块
- c# - 使用 C# 从 firebase 获取所有集合